Testimony of Margit Silberfeld, born in Jihlava, Czechoslovakia, 1928, regarding her experiences in Prague and Theresienstadt
The family owns a carpet shop; death of her father; life before the war.
German occupation; move to Prague; attends a Jewish school; deportation to the Theresienstadt Ghetto; life in the ghetto and help from a SS officer Karl Rahn, who saved relatives; visit of the Red Cross.
